Compare all specifications:
1944 Ford Taunus | 2012 Daihatsu Sirion | |
Make | Ford | Daihatsu |
Model | Taunus | Sirion |
Year Released | 1944 | 2012 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1172 cc | 998 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 3 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 34 HP | 69 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line - Premium |
Drive Type | Rear |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
